JOB SUMMARY:
Provides behavior analysis in the nonpublic school program. Designs and implements an individualized behavioral plan for each student. With the other Lincoln school staff, is responsible for integrating students behavioral plans with the educational and treatment programs.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
· Completes Functional Analysis Assessments for all NPS students
· Provide behavior analysis services in collaboration with others who support and/or provide services to one’s clients.
· Completes Behavioral Intervention Plans for all NPS students.
· Monitors success of Behavioral Intervention Plans.
· Serves as Behavior Intervention Case Manager for all students.
· Make recommendations regarding target outcomes and intervention strategies.
· Determine and make environmental changes that reduce the need for behavior analysis services.
· Provide competency-based training for persons who are responsible for carrying out behavioral assessment and behavior change procedures.
· Use effective performance monitoring and reinforcement systems.
· Design and use systems for monitoring procedural integrity.
· Establish support for behavior analysis services from persons directly and indirectly involved with these services.
· Secure the support of others to maintain the clients’ behavioral repertoires.
